When you log in, are you selecting "remember me"?

If not, that could be part of the problem. Select that and it will automatically log you back in if your session times out or is otherwise lost.

Sessions are based on:
1. cookies
2. ip address

If your ip address changes radically, that will reset your session. If you've selected "remember me" it _should_ still log you back in without any noticeable interruption.

However, if browser cookies are getting cleared, there is no way for vbulletin to compensate. In that case, you'll need to keep your iphone browser from clearing the cookies vbulletin depends on.
